Send us Fan MailProf. Solberg recently published an academic paper in response to Caleb Hegg (link below) and in this pre-recorded video, he'll work through that paper and explain his response to Caleb’s various arguments. This is the next installment in a lively, ongoing conversation regarding the big question we posed on this channel: “Are animal sacrifices still required to atone for sin?” Caleb’s argument is one of the most sophisticated and well laid out cases we've seen for future sin sacrifices and well worth taking the time to understand and analyze.
